> During "slider upgrade" command e.g. to add a new component; the slider AM 
> itself restarts.
> One slide use case is deploy a service via slider and create a new component 
> for every new user of service. New components are added via "slider upgrade" 
> so existing components (i.e. users) are not impacted by down time. During 
> each component upgrade the AM also restarts and all existing components have 
> to know the new AM before they can heartbeat to it.
> Per discussions, the AM restart during upgrade is being done to pick up new 
> Yarn parameters.
> However, in this use case, Hadoop cluster yarn parameters are not being 
> changed; neither are parameters to any of the existing components. Thus the 
> AM restart in this case seems to provide no benefit - though it brings a 
> small risk that any issue in AM restart will shut down the entire application 
> (i.e. impact all running users).
> An option should be provided during the upgrade to NOT do AM restart - 
> allowing users of slider to have a choice.
